Subject: Handover — webhook retry semantics

Hi Tomas,

Handing over the Bellwick webhook delivery pipeline. For plugin authors: failed deliveries retry with exponential backoff — 1m, 5m, 30m, 2h, then every 6h for up to three days. A 410 response permanently disables the endpoint; anything else counts as retryable. Duplicate deliveries are possible, so consumers must be idempotent on the event ID. The delivery log table keeps 30 days of attempts. To audit retries yourself, connect with the string below.

primary connection of yagag-kaguf = mssql://praox_svc:wUPY5WS@db-c12a.sivrelio.corp:5432/gordor

14:22 — So here's where it got interesting: the ScanPort handheld firmware started echoing raw barcode payloads into the debug log, including the staff badge codes. Not great. Teo pulled the integration offline within six minutes and we rotated all badge codes by end of day. No evidence of external access, but flagging for your review anyway. The affected firmware image can be identified by the token below.

trace token, fafof-tajef: htk9_849b0fd88

## Artifact Signing — Kiosk Watchdog

The Pellbright kiosk runs a watchdog that verifies every binary it restarts against a signed manifest. If verification fails, the watchdog refuses the restart and boots the last known-good build instead, so an unsigned or mis-signed release will silently roll back in the field. Before promoting a build, sign both the binary and the manifest with the same key, and confirm the checksum pair matches in the release log. All watchdog-verified releases must be signed with the key below.

release key, hadug-kawef: bky13_mPGeFZeR1GZ1G